Gus Hamer.....Cov and United have a 'valuation' gap on 10:31 - Aug 5 with 1469 views_CliveBaker_

I hope not. He would be a very August 2024 Ipswich Town signing.

He's a good player at that level, but he's 29 years old, his only season in the Premier League was in a Sheffield United side that stunk the place out, and he's not likely to bridge the gap between Championship and Prem. Had he not played for Cov previously I doubt their fans would be desperate for him back either.
